Output e9c80489c50187cd42f75295fb7d244b7f19d2d34f90c8ad6eca245657e46821:9

value
19877564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828b4b8cdec0df900754094b39e10d565c4c420e OP_EQUAL
address
MKoQwmBkTe1iAAHF3tsajvj1F2gpbFo1Um
transaction
e9c80489c50187cd42f75295fb7d244b7f19d2d34f90c8ad6eca245657e46821
spent
true